Default If i buy greddy???

Ok guys i have a questions guys if i buy the greddy kit is there anything else i need to buy. Or realy should buy. I want to get is soon and i wan to be able to put it on and go the best i can. Also my car is a 1991 with Power steering and AC and cruze control is that a issue with the greddy kit?

no issue as the kit comes you stand to gain 30-40 whp just install and retard base timming. From there the options from there the options begin but like i said they are options not necescities. Bipes, some 300cc injectors, WI, Wideband 02, and, an IC, are all base options wich will allow you to hit anywhere from 200-250whp if you know what you are doing, and tune it carefully. From there the options progress to bigger downpipes, and an ecu of some sort with bigger injectors. No matter what you do the stock clutch is going to hate life past 140whp. So if that is an issue for you get the base Greddy kit, a ebay IC, make a 5$ MBC or get it off ebay, return timmng to a more normal setting and enjoy life at the edge of what the clutch will give you. If you run into problems there a replacement fuel pump will give you abit more pressure headroom,as the stock pump is not good for much more than 70 or so psi, and a walboro 190 high pressure is like 95$ from lightning motorsports. So let us know how far you wanna go and we can show you how to get there and help you troubleshoot any problems you might run into. The more time you spend reading this site, the easier all of this will be on you. There is alot of good research here. GL man If money is no option though a Begi or FM is better.
